500X 可扩展性实验指标计算与统一动态框架

[

[

Pinterest Engineering

](https://medium.com/@Pinterest_Engineering?source=post_page---byline--9eb356fee676---------------------------------------)

](https://medium.com/@Pinterest_Engineering?source=post_page---byline--9eb356fee676---------------------------------------)

Xinyue Cao | Software Engineer Tech Lead; Bojun Lin | Software Engineer

Xinyue Cao | 软件工程师技术负责人; Bojun Lin | 软件工程师

Overview

概述

Experimentation is a cornerstone of data-driven decision making at Pinterest. Every day, thousands of experiments run on our platform, generating insights that drive product decisions and business strategies. By the end of 2024, over 1,500 metrics — created by experiment users — are computed daily on our Experimentation Platform to meet diverse analytical needs.

实验是 Pinterest 数据驱动决策的基石。每天,成千上万的实验在我们的平台上运行,生成推动产品决策和商业战略的洞察。到 2024 年底,超过 1,500 个由实验用户创建的指标将在我们的实验平台上每天计算,以满足多样化的分析需求。

But as the scale of experimentation grew, so did the challenges. Delays in upstream data ingestion, difficulties in backfilling skipped metrics, and frequent scalability issues began to hinder our ability to deliver timely and reliable results.

但是随着实验规模的扩大,挑战也随之增加。上游数据摄取的延迟、跳过指标的回填困难以及频繁的可扩展性问题开始妨碍我们及时可靠地交付结果的能力。

Enter the Unified Dynamic Framework (UDF) — a scalable, resilient solution that has transformed how we compute experiment metrics. With UDF, our pipelines now support 100X metrics and are designed to scale up to 500X in the coming years. This framework has not only ditched all upstream dependencies and accelerated metric delivery but also reduced engineering effort from months to days to build data pipelines, enabling faster experimentation and innovation. Essentially, it achieves standardization of metric processing for Pinterest experimentation. Engineers are able to focus solely on innovation of metric computation because the majority of the infrastructure challenges and pipeline creation complexities are offloaded to the unified dynamic framework.

引入统一动态框架 (UDF) — 一种可扩展、弹性的解决方案,彻底改变了我们计算实验指标的方式。通过UDF,我们的管道现在支持100倍的指标,并设计为在未来几年内扩展到500倍。这个框架不仅消除了所有上游依赖,加速了指标交...

开通本站会员,查看完整译文。

Home - Wiki
Copyright © 2011-2025 iteam. Current version is 2.143.0. UTC+08:00, 2025-05-21 06:41
浙ICP备14020137号-1 $Map of visitor$